This course will allow you to breach another "Great Wall of China"--the language barrier. We will learn the basics of Mandarin Chinese (called Hanyu, Putonghua, or Guoyu) the national language of both the People's Republic of China (PRC) and the Republic of China (ROC, or Taiwan.) During the first two weeks of CN 125 we will concentrate on the sound system and writing system covered in the introductory portion of our textbook. During the remainder of the first semester we will proceed to some of the more basic sentence patterns, vocabulary and characters introduced in Lessons 1-8. In the second semester (CN 126) we will continue to learn basic sentence patterns. Vocabulary will be introduced in the pinyin romanization system; we will learn characters in their traditional (rather than simplified) form.
